The Traditional Equipment Disposal Dilemma

For decades, municipal public works directors have relied on a narrow set of options when retiring fleet assets. The sealed-bid process, while transparent, typically attracts only local buyers aware of the opportunity through newspaper notices or municipal websites. Trade-ins to dealerships offer convenience but rarely deliver fair market value, as dealers must price for resale margins. Private party sales demand significant staff time for advertising, showing equipment, and processing paperwork: resources most departments cannot spare.

The fundamental limitation of these traditional methods is market access. A 2008 Peterbilt refuse truck might fetch $35,000 from a local hauler, but a fleet operator three states away actively searching for that exact chassis configuration might pay $48,000. Traditional disposal methods never connect these two parties. The municipality leaves $13,000 on the table: money that could fund safety upgrades, employee training, or deferred maintenance elsewhere in the fleet.

Digital Transformation in Asset Liquidation

The emergence of specialized online waste equipment auction platforms has fundamentally altered the economics of surplus disposal. Unlike general auction sites or heavy equipment marketplaces, these niche platforms aggregate buyers specifically seeking surplus municipal waste equipment and surplus waste equipment auction opportunities. This targeted approach solves the market access problem by connecting municipal sellers with a national: and increasingly international: buyer base of private haulers, smaller municipalities, and equipment resellers.

The operational model differs significantly from consumer-facing auction sites. Most platforms serving the waste industry operate on a buyer-premium structure, charging winning bidders a percentage fee (typically 8-12%) while listing remains free for municipalities. This inverted fee structure aligns platform incentives with seller outcomes: the platform profits only when equipment sells at competitive prices.

From a public finance perspective, this structure eliminates upfront costs and risk. A public works department listing a 2015 Heil front loader pays nothing if the equipment fails to meet reserve pricing. If it sells, the municipality receives 100% of the hammer price, with the buyer absorbing transaction costs. This contrasts sharply with consignment dealerships, which deduct 15-25% commissions from gross proceeds.

Quantifiable Financial Benefits

The revenue differential between traditional and online disposal methods is substantial and well-documented. Consider the case of Trenton, New Jersey, which pivoted to online auctions during the 2020 pandemic. Facing revenue shortfalls and unable to conduct in-person property auctions, the city sold 49 surplus properties through a digital platform, generating $4.15 million in a single day. While this example involves real estate rather than equipment, the underlying principles apply: expanded buyer participation drives competitive bidding, which maximizes realized value.

In the waste equipment sector specifically, municipalities report 20-35% higher net proceeds from online waste equipment auction sales compared to sealed-bid processes. A Western states municipality recently sold a 2012 Mack chassis roll-off truck through an online auction for $67,500, receiving bids from seven qualified buyers across four states. The previous year, a comparable unit sold via sealed bid for $52,000 with only two local bidders participating.

The mathematics are straightforward: more qualified buyers equals more competitive pressure equals higher closing prices. Digital platforms remove geographic friction, allowing a buyer in Maine to compete with a buyer in Oregon for equipment located in Colorado. For municipalities managing multi-million dollar equipment portfolios, these incremental gains compound significantly over fleet lifecycles.

Operational Efficiency and Administrative Relief

Beyond direct revenue impacts, online platforms deliver substantial administrative efficiencies. Traditional sealed-bid processes require extensive staff time: drafting bid specifications, publishing legal notices, scheduling inspection appointments, managing paperwork, and processing payments. A typical sealed-bid disposal might consume 12-18 staff hours across multiple departments (legal, finance, fleet management).

Digital auction platforms automate most of these processes. Equipment listings can be created in 15-20 minutes using standardized templates. Photographs are uploaded directly by fleet staff. Inspection appointments self-schedule through calendar integration. Winning bid notifications, invoice generation, and payment processing occur automatically. Post-sale documentation: critical for audit compliance: is digitally archived and searchable.

This automation delivers measurable cost savings. Assuming a $45/hour fully-burdened labor rate, reducing disposal processing time from 15 hours to 3 hours saves $540 per asset. For a municipality disposing of 20 pieces of equipment annually, that's $10,800 in recovered staff capacity: resources that can be redirected to core service delivery.

Transparency mechanisms also reduce administrative burden. Time-stamped bid histories, automated outbid notifications, and digital title transfer documentation create clear audit trails. These features prove particularly valuable during budget reviews or when justifying disposal decisions to elected officials and taxpayers.

Environmental Stewardship Through Asset Reallocation

The environmental case for online waste equipment auctions extends beyond the obvious emissions reductions of digital transactions versus physical auctions. The more significant impact lies in equipment reallocation and lifecycle extension.

When surplus municipal waste equipment sells to qualified buyers through specialized marketplaces, it typically remains in productive service. A front-loader retired from municipal routes at 80,000 miles might serve a small private hauler for another 40,000 miles before final disposition. This extended useful life delays new equipment manufacturing: a significant environmental benefit given the embodied carbon in refuse truck production.

Compare this to the alternative: equipment that fails to sell through limited traditional channels often proceeds directly to scrap. While metal recycling has environmental value, it's far less efficient than continued use. A 2018 lifecycle analysis published in the Journal of Industrial Ecology found that extending heavy equipment service life by 25% reduces total lifecycle emissions by 12-18% compared to early retirement and replacement.

For municipalities pursuing sustainability goals or ISO 14001 certification, equipment reallocation through online auctions provides quantifiable environmental metrics. Fleet managers can report "X tons of equipment diverted from scrap" or "Y estimated years of extended service life achieved through resale." These data points support broader sustainability reporting and demonstrate environmental leadership to constituents.

Best Practices for Municipal Implementation

Successfully transitioning to online waste equipment disposal requires strategic planning and policy alignment. Leading municipalities have identified several critical success factors:

Asset Evaluation Protocols: Establish clear criteria for retirement timing and reserve pricing. Equipment should be surplused when it retains resale value but before maintenance costs exceed operating efficiency. Overly conservative retention policies leave money on the table; premature disposal reduces fleet capacity.

Photography and Documentation Standards: Online buyers cannot physically inspect equipment before bidding. High-quality photographs from standardized angles (exterior sides, interior cab, engine compartment, hydraulic systems, hour meter) significantly impact bidding confidence and final prices. Municipalities achieving top-tier results invest in basic photography training for fleet staff.

Title and Lien Clearance: Streamline title release procedures before listing. Delayed title transfers frustrate buyers and damage seller reputations. Work with municipal attorneys to pre-approve standard asset sale agreements and establish clear signature authority for fleet disposals below specified thresholds.

Reserve Pricing Strategy: Set reserves at 70-75% of estimated fair market value based on recent comparable sales. This provides downside protection while allowing market dynamics to drive pricing. Overly aggressive reserves result in no-sales and relisting costs.

Buyer Communication: Respond promptly to pre-bid questions. Municipalities with 24-hour response protocols achieve 15-20% higher bid participation rates. Transparency about known defects or maintenance history builds buyer confidence and reduces post-sale disputes.

Strategic Implications for Municipal Fleet Management

The shift toward online waste equipment disposal has broader strategic implications for municipal fleet management. As digital marketplaces mature and buyer networks expand, equipment liquidity increases. Higher liquidity enables more dynamic fleet replacement strategies.

Historically, many municipalities retained equipment well beyond optimal retirement points due to disposal friction and uncertain resale values. If selling a 12-year-old packer might yield $15,000 or might yield $30,000 depending on whether the "right buyer" happens to see the classified ad, risk-averse fleet managers opt to retain longer.

Online auctions with national buyer reach reduce this uncertainty. Fleet managers can project disposal proceeds more accurately, enabling more confident replacement decisions. This supports optimal fleet age profiles, which in turn reduce maintenance costs and improve service reliability.

Some forward-thinking municipalities are exploring "rolling replacement" strategies enabled by predictable online disposal proceeds. Rather than replacing all front-loaders in year X and all roll-offs in year Y (creating budget spikes), continuous replacement schedules smooth capital expenses while maintaining younger average fleet age.
